Reaction Injection Molding (RIM) is an innovative manufacturing process used to produce the large and complex plastic parts with high flexibility, strength and durability. RIM involves the mixing of liquid bi-component polyurethanes in a mixer at certain amount ratio, then injecting the liquid mixture at room temperature and low pressure into mold cavity where the mixture reacts and cures into a solid part.
Reaction Injection Molding Process Steps:
Mixing: two liquid polyurethanes are mixed together in a mixer at certain amount ratio.
Injection: the mixed liquid polyurethanes are injected into mold cavity under low pressure and room temperature.
Reaction: The liquid mixture reacts and cures inside the mold cavity and forms a solid part.
Demolding: The solid part is manually taken out from the mold cavity.
One advantage of RIM is its ability to produce large parts with a smooth and high-quality surface finishing, as well as the complex geometries and intricate details. Another advantage of RIM is its ability to produce parts with high strength and durability, which makes RIM parts ideal for applications that durability is a critical factor, such as industries of automotive, medical devices, aerospace, etc.
RIM Parts Design Considerations:
When designing parts for RIM production, it's important to consider factors such as size, structure, wall thickness, draft angles, and gating. RIM parts can be designed with complex geometries and intricate details, but it's important to ensure that the part design is manufacturable and the tooling favors the design.
This was an Engine Casing that was originally manufactured by the sheet metal fabrication with lots of welding. To save cost, customer modified the design of this casing to be Reaction Injection Molded. The different wall thicknesses of 5/7/10/20 mm brought challenge to shrinkage control.
Due to the low injection molding temperatures and pressures, RIM is well-suited for molding large parts with variable wall thickness and smooth surface finishes. We can also benefit from its relatively high turnover rate, which makes it proficient in handling low to middle volume production projects. In addition, RIM parts have high tensile strength, heat resistance, and good resistance to corrosive acids or solvents. However, prolonged exposure to sunlight can degrade polymer-based parts.
Our RIM tooling was usually made of Epoxy Resin & Silicone Rubber, the silicone rubber pieces were usually replaced after 100 shots. Low-Pressure & Room-Temperature Injection Molding required fairly low mold locking force, thus the simple clamps were fine for our RIM process.

One shot of injection molding time was around 40 seconds. More big size and volume of the part, More time of the reaction injection molding. Insert Molding and Overmolding were also feasible for our RIM process. 4 stainless steel M6 nuts were inserted for injection molding.
Industry Applications:
RIM is commonly used in the low volume manufacturing or prototyping of automotive, aerospace, medical devices, and consumer goods parts. Such as automotive bumpers & grills, body panels, interior components, aerospace ducting, large enclosures, big housings and medical covering shells.
